I found this beautiful Wood and Son's English pottery plate for $3.50.
As you may glimpse over on the wall I love to collect various transferware patterns and mix and match on table scapes.... I have a red, blue, and black collection. I have very few serving pieces in blue and I loved this Mason Ironstone Blue and White by Crabtree Evelyn of London for $6.25.
I have been looking for a blue and white planter for some time... I dont know the maker of this but for 9 dollars I was ecstatic!
On one of the clearance tables I found this fabulous Villeroy Boch plate... Made in Luxenbourg... I thought it would be gorgoeus as a wall plate when I am serving my black and whites!!!
with and without a flash... I love castles and this one is magnificent!
I paid $8 but I couldnt find a comparable price online....
Last, but certainly not least, I found this wonderful springy cup and saucer....
Staffordshire Bouquet by Johnson Brothers... of England... I thought Id enjoy my springtime morning coffee and tea in this spritely cup, especially at only $5.00 for the pair.
Altogether I spent $31.50 but I daresay I saved an equal amount if Id purchased these treasures in any other way!
